Research interest

Our group develops bioanalytical methods using mass spectrometry. The projects include:

Testing of narcotics

–The development of bioanalytical tests of amphetamine, ketamine, and opiates, the most commonly abused drugs in Taiwan. The tests will be applied in different samples, such as urine, plasma, saliva, and exhaled breath.

Aging

–Quantification of advanced glycation end-products (AGEs) in human plasma. We will evaluate the efficiency of derivatization for AGEs using LC-MS/MS.

Metabolomics

–Quantification of indole-3-acetic acid biosynthesis pathway in bacteria

–Identification of drug-resistant strains of bacteria using metabolomic strategy

Environment

–The development of analytical assays for determining endocrine-disruptor compounds and antibiotics in soil
